Important Information

  • Make sure you use MCreator 2026.1 (1.21.8) or 2026.2 1st snapshot (26.1.2)
  • Back up your workspace before updating to a newer version of the plugin.
  • Mods will also require Fabric API to function properly, so when you want to play your mod, make sure you have Fabric API.
  • Some features are disabled because they are Forge-related features. We are working on them.

License

  • Licensed under the GNU Lesser General Public License, version 3.0  
  • Mods created with this tool may be closed-source and/or distributed with a different license.
  • Appropriate credit must be provided to the creators and maintainers of this software.
  • Forked versions of this software must be distributed under the same license as this with attribution if distributed.
  • Changes must be stated if any modified works are to be distributed.
  • Under no circumstances can you state that the original creator endorses modified works.

Latest versions:

2026.2-2.7 (26.1.2)

You will most certainly encounter many build errors and/or bugs as I haven't tested and fixed everything yet. Please report them on GitHub

THIS IS NOT A VERSION MADE FOR PRODUCTION. PLEASE USE FOR TESTING PURPOSES ONLY.

- Added support for Minecraft 26.1.2 with Fabric API 0.150.0
  - GLOBAL_MAP and GLOBAL_WORLD scopes for variables have been temporarily disabled
  - Tint types for custom blocks have also been temporarily disabled

2026.1-2.6.2 (1.21.8)

- Removed unsupported procedures
- [Bugfix] player_useitem_stop trigger was causing a build error with itemstack dependency
- [Bugfix #593] Custom dimensions with no portal triggered procedure caused a build error.
- Some other bug fixes
